"US Sanctions are No Match" Huawei Achieves 185 Trillion Won in Sales, Reclaims China Phone Throne
Despite US sanctions, Huawei recorded its second-highest performance ever last year, achieving 880 billion yuan (approximately 185 trillion won) in sales.
